Affects:
- Firefox 3.0.3 and prior
- Firefox 2.0.0.17 and earlier
Description:
The nsXMLHttpRequest::NotifyEventListeners method in affected versions of Firefox allows remote attackers to bypass the same-origin policy and execute arbitrary script via multiple listeners, which bypass the inner window check.
Resolution and Availability of Patch:
This issue can be addressed by updating Firefox to version 3.0.4 or version 2.0.0.18, both of which are currently available in the OLEX Certified Library.

CVE Identifier: CVE-2008-5022
Vulnerability Type(s): Authentication Issues
Severity: High
